Appetite Hormones

Appetite hormones such as ghrelin and leptin signal hunger and fullness between the gut, fat tissue, and brain. Sleep loss, stress, and aggressive deficits can skew these signals so you feel hungrier despite adequate calories on paper.

Protein-rich meals, consistent sleep, and realistic deficits help re-tune signaling over time.
